Leonidas Hubbard (politician)
Leonidas Hubbard (born October 26, 1823, in Hawley, Massachusetts; died March 28, 1895, in Racine, Wisconsin) was an American politician and lawyer. He served in the Wisconsin State Assembly and the Wisconsin State Senate.
Hubbard moved to Wisconsin in 1848 and settled in Racine. He was a prominent figure in the Republican Party in Wisconsin and held several local and state offices. He served in the Wisconsin State Assembly in 1862 and 1863, representing Racine County. He subsequently served in the Wisconsin State Senate from 1864 to 1865, representing the 10th District.
Hubbard was a successful lawyer and was known for his dedication to public service. His contributions to Wisconsin politics were significant during the Civil War era. He is buried in Mound Cemetery in Racine, Wisconsin.
